+//===- WebAssemblyPrepareForLiveIntervals.cpp - Prepare for LiveIntervals -===//
+//
+// The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ure
+//
+// This file is distributed under the University of Illinois Open Source
+// License. See LICENSE.TXT for details.
+//
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+///
+/// \file
+/// \brief Fix up code to meet LiveInterval's requirements.
+///
+/// Some CodeGen passes don't preserve LiveInterval's requirements, because
+/// they run after register allocation and it isn't important. However,
+/// WebAssembly runs LiveIntervals in a late pass. This pass transforms code
+/// to meet LiveIntervals' requirements; primarily, it ensures that all
+/// virtual register uses have definitions (IMPLICIT_DEF definitions if
+/// nothing else).
+///
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+
+#include "WebAssembly.h"
+#include "MCTargetDesc/WebAssemblyMCTargetDesc.h"
+#include "WebAssemblyMachineFunctionInfo.h"
+#include "WebAssemblySubtarget.h"
+#include "llvm/CodeGen/MachineFunctionPass.h"
+#include "llvm/CodeGen/MachineInstrBuilder.h"
+#include "llvm/CodeGen/MachineRegisterInfo.h"
+#include "llvm/CodeGen/Passes.h"
+#include "llvm/Support/Debug.h"
+#include "llvm/Support/raw_ostream.h"
+using namespace llvm;
+
+#define DEBUG_TYPE "wasm-prepare-for-live-intervals"
+
+namespace {
+class WebAssemblyPrepareForLiveIntervals final : public MachineFunctionPass {
+public:
+ static char ID; // Pass identification, replacement for typeid
+ WebAssemblyPrepareForLiveIntervals() : MachineFunctionPass(ID) {}
+
+private:
+ const char *getPassName() const override {
+ return "WebAssembly Prepare For LiveIntervals";
+ }
+
+ void getAnalysisUsage(AnalysisUsage &AU) const override {
+ AU.setPreservesCFG();
+ MachineFunctionPass::getAnalysisUsage(AU);
+ }
+
+ bool runOnMachineFunction(MachineFunction &MF) override;
+};
+} // end anonymous namespace
+
+char WebAssemblyPrepareForLiveIntervals::ID = 0;
+FunctionPass *llvm::createWebAssemblyPrepareForLiveIntervals() {
+ return new WebAssemblyPrepareForLiveIntervals();
+}
+
+/// Test whether the given instruction is an ARGUMENT.
+static bool IsArgument(const MachineInstr *MI) {
+ switch (MI->getOpcode()) {
+ case WebAssembly::ARGUMENT_I32:
+ case WebAssembly::ARGUMENT_I64:
+ case WebAssembly::ARGUMENT_F32:
+ case WebAssembly::ARGUMENT_F64:
+ return true;
+ default:
+ return false;
+ }
+}
+
+// Test whether the given register has an ARGUMENT def.
+static bool HasArgumentDef(unsigned Reg, const MachineRegisterInfo &MRI) {
+ for (auto &Def : MRI.def_instructions(Reg))
+ if (IsArgument(&Def))
+ return true;
+ return false;
+}
+
+bool WebAssemblyPrepareForLiveIntervals::runOnMachineFunction(MachineFunction &MF) {
+ DEBUG({
+ dbgs() << "********** Prepare For LiveIntervals **********\n"
+ << "********** Function: " << MF.getName() << '\n';
+ });
+
+ bool Changed = false;
+ MachineRegisterInfo &MRI = MF.getRegInfo();
+ const auto &TII = *MF.getSubtarget<WebAssemblySubtarget>().getInstrInfo();
+ MachineBasicBlock &Entry = *MF.begin();
+
+ assert(!mustPreserveAnalysisID(LiveIntervalsID) &&
+ "LiveIntervals shouldn't be active yet!");
+
+ // We don't preserve SSA form.
+ MRI.leaveSSA();
+
+ // BranchFolding and perhaps other passes don't preserve IMPLICIT_DEF
+ // instructions. LiveIntervals requires that all paths to virtual register
+ // uses provide a definition. Insert IMPLICIT_DEFs in the entry block to
+ // conservatively satisfy this.
+ //
+ // TODO: This is fairly heavy-handed; find a better approach.
+ //
+ for (unsigned i = 0, e = MRI.getNumVirtRegs(); i < e; ++i) {
+ unsigned Reg = TargetRegisterInfo::index2VirtReg(i);
+
+ // Skip unused registers.
+ if (MRI.use_nodbg_empty(Reg))
+ continue;
+
+ // Skip registers that have an ARGUMENT definition.
+ if (HasArgumentDef(Reg, MRI))
+ continue;
+
+ BuildMI(Entry, Entry.begin(), DebugLoc(),
+ TII.get(WebAssembly::IMPLICIT_DEF), Reg);
+ Changed = true;
+ }
+
+ // Move ARGUMENT_* instructions to the top of the entry block, so that their
+ // liveness reflects the fact that these really are live-in values.
+ for (auto MII = Entry.begin(), MIE = Entry.end(); MII != MIE; ) {
+ MachineInstr *MI = &*MII++;
+ if (IsArgument(MI)) {
+ MI->removeFromParent();
+ Entry.insert(Entry.begin(), MI);
+ }
+ }
+
+ // Ok, we're now ready to run LiveIntervalAnalysis again.
+ MF.getProperties().set(MachineFunctionProperties::Property::TracksLiveness);
+
+ return Changed;
+}
